The process of examining malicious software to understand its behavior, origin, and impact. Static analysis inspects code without executing it. Dynamic analysis runs malware in a controlled environment to observe its actions. Results inform detection signatures, incident response actions, and threat intelligence reports.
Malware analysis is an advanced cybersecurity skill that supports SOC operations, incident response, and threat intelligence. Incident responders analyze malware to determine what an attacker accomplished during a breach. Threat intelligence analysts attribute malware samples to specific threat groups. Security engineers use analysis results to build detection rules.
